Book Description

1 Mar 2010 Rough Guide
The Rough Guide to Camping in Britain reviews over three hundred of the UK's best sites, travelling from Scilly to Shetland, taking in Yorkshire hills, Hampshire glampsites, Welsh Islands and Highland co-operatives. This full colour guide is packed with practical detail and is written by campers for campers. Rough Guide writers have visited every site featured, checking out views, testing the shower temperatures and spending night after night under canvas. The Rough Guide to Camping in Britain features camping equipment, cooking, wild camping, festivals and adventure sports whilst pictures bring the splendid sites to life and indexes, maps and lists arranged by category help you navigate the guide with ease. The Rough Guide to Camping in Britain is the complete companion for novice campers who don't know where to start and experienced tent-riggers looking for a new destination. Whether you want snug tipis and creature comforts or simple sites in stunning wilderness locations, The Rough Guide to Camping in Britain has it covered.

5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ent campsite bible 29 Aug 2010
I bought this book because everytime I go camping, I'm faced with an endless task of trawling the internet for reputable campsites and feel I have to find out about all the possibilities before I can make a decision. This book means that I have comparable information on a few recommended campsites and I can choose quickly.

I chose this book over others as I didn't need the 'beginners guide to camping' - type basic information that all the other equivalents seem to have.

I have camped at two of the campsites from this book in Cornwall and was very pleased with both of them.

5.0 out of 5 stars The only campsite guide you will ever need. 6 April 2010
Without doubt the best campsite guide on the market this year and I have compared it against the three other guides bought/delivered this year. It is colourful, informative and comprehensive. The only negative point being that no downside to the campsites are mentioned, but this is a minor fault. The choice of locations is more than sufficient and the photography used will make this guide a good coffee table publication.If you are a proper tent camper this is the guide for you.
